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 001 Hazard:
29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13): Each employee(s) eng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els were not protected by guardrail systems, safety net system, or personal fall arrest system, nor were employee(s) provided with an alternative fall protection measure under another provision of paragraph 1926.501 (b): On or about 1/11/2024 and at times prior, at 5715 Double Eagle Circle, Ave Maria, Florida, three employees were exposed to a 32-foot fall hazard while installing trusses and roof facia of a residential building without the use of a conventional fall protection method.
